Hamilton Zanze, a San Francisco-based multifamily real estate investment firm, announced that it has sold Tresa at Arrowhead, a 360-unit, garden-style community in Glendale, Ariz. The firm sponsored the acquisition of the property in May 2016 and closed the disposition Feb. 26.
“The sale of Tresa at Arrowhead marks our 16th disposition in Arizona,” said Anthony Ly, senior director of transactions at Hamilton Zanze. “Arizona was among the initial markets Hamilton Zanze entered since our founding in 2001, and we’ve remained steadfast believers in the attributes of the state. Our continued activity in the market underscores our strong track record here, and we’ll continue to pursue future opportunities.”
